Regulatory Framework
The regulatory framework for online casinos in Australia is complex and multifaceted. The country has a well-established gambling industry, with a range of laws and regulations in place to ensure the integrity and fairness of gambling activities.
The primary regulatory body responsible for overseeing the online casino industry in Australia is the Australian Communications and Media Authority (ACMA). The ACMA is responsible for ensuring that online casinos operating in Australia comply with the country’s gambling laws and regulations.
- The Interactive Gambling Act 2001 (IGA) is a key piece of legislation that regulates online gambling in Australia. The IGA prohibits online casinos from offering real-money gambling services to Australian residents, with some exceptions.
- The IGA also requires online casinos to obtain a license from the ACMA before offering services to Australian residents. The license is valid for a period of three years and requires the online casino to meet a range of strict criteria, including ensuring the integrity and fairness of their games.
- The IGA also prohibits online casinos from advertising their services to Australian residents, with some exceptions. This is designed to prevent online casinos from targeting vulnerable individuals, such as problem gamblers.
Despite the IGA, some online casinos continue to operate in Australia, often without a license. These online casinos are often referred to as “rogue” operators, and they are not subject to the same level of regulation and oversight as licensed online casinos.
As a result, it is important for Australian residents to be cautious when choosing an online casino. They should look for online casinos that are licensed and regulated by a reputable authority, such as the ACMA. They should also ensure that the online casino is transparent about its games and payout rates, and that it has a good reputation for fairness and integrity.
